[[#W-3]] ### W-1 **Launch Date**: June 12 2023 **Reentry Date**: Feb 21 2024 **Launch Vehicle**: [SpaceX Falcon 9 Transporter-8](https://www.nasaspaceflight.com/2023/06/spacex-transporter-8/) 🔗 https://www.varda.com/missions/w-1 The W-1 capsule launched as part of [SpaceX's Transporter-8 rideshare mission](https://spacenews.com/spacex-launches-eighth-dedicated-smallsat-rideshare-mission/) on June 12, 2023. It spent over eight months in orbit before successfully reentering at the Utah Test and Training Range (UTTR) on February 21, 2024. The W-1 capsule carried an experiment to crystallize Ritonavir, an antiviral drug used to treat HIV and hepatitis C, in microgravity conditions. It spent six weeks in orbit before successfully reentering at the Koonibba Test Range in South Australia, operated by [Southern Launch](https://www.southernlaunch.space/). The W-2 capsule carried payloads from Varda partners, including a spectrometer from the Air Force Research Laboratory (AFRL), and employed a heatshield with a Thermal Protection System (TPS) developed in collaboration with [[NASA]]’s Ames Research Center in California’s Silicon Valley. It spent six weeks in orbit before reentering at the Utah Test and Training Range, operated by the [[U.S. Air Force]]. The W-3 capsule carried payloads from Varda partners, including advanced materials experiments for commercial customers and a reentry sensor suite for [[NASA]]. The W-4 mission is the maiden flight for Varda’s new satellite bus, designed and built in Varda’s El Segundo headquarters and manufacturing facility, and marks several other firsts for the company and the ever-expanding orbital economy. This mission will be the first that utilizes a [Varda-made satellite bus](https://spacenews.com/varda-to-launch-its-first-in-house-designed-spacecraft-for-on-orbit-manufacturing/). While the mission profile will be the same as previous missions, the entirety of this mission, with the exception of launch, is built and fully operated by Varda. While in orbit, the satellite bus will provide the capsule with power, communications, attitude control, and propulsion. Once the orbital manufacturing portion of the mission is complete, the W-4 capsule will separate from the satellite bus and reenter the Earth’s atmosphere at speeds exceeding Mach 25 and ultimately land safely at the [Koonibba Test Range](https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Koonibba_Test_Range) in South Australia, operated by Southern Launch.
